Police
Pondicherry anarchy

My car was rammed into by a speeding motor bike in front of the Orleanpet bus stand in Pondicherry with resultant damage to the rear indicator glasses and the adjoining body of the car. I got to speak to the person responsible for the incident who pleaded guilty and showed his willingness to pay for the damages. After noting his mobile and vehicle numbers, initially I decided to spare him the troubles of an FIR at the police station only to find that he subsequently refused to pay damages or pick the phone. Irked by his response, I finally decided to register a case against him at the traffic police station the next day. I found four duty officers at the police station who listened to my tale and asked me to come the next day to file the case stating that the Head Constable was not available. The situation next day was no different except that the team at the station were three other men in the similar white uniforms. On the third day, I was asked to wait the whole day at the station to register the case only to be told in the evening that the head constable and the SI were busy with a political meeting. Determined to have my complaint registered I went to the station on the fourth day. I got to meet the SI who told me that all the officers who I had seen the other days were police constables and I should have registered the case with them. I was beginning to feel better until he told me to come two days later to register the case as they were busy with the preparations for the Independence Day celebrations. I don't think I need to specify what happened when I got there on day 6.

Now that I can't register a complaint with the police against them, let the readers decide if there is any way out of this anarchy in Pondicherry.
